Shift investment inland to ease pressure on coast – Dr Boerboom

Dr. Luc Boerboom, an Associate Professor at the University of Twente in the Netherlands, has proposed a shift in investment focus from the Abidjan-Lagos Corridor to emerging inland areas in Ghana and Côte d’Ivoire. This shift is aimed at reducing development pressure on coastal communities and building their resilience against climate-related challenges, particularly flooding.

Boerboom made this recommendation during the third session of the Steering Committee on the Improved Resilience of Coastal Communities in Côte d’Ivoire and Ghana, held in Accra.
